Friday, June 13, 2008

DEMOLITION

The hard work is under way and we keep tearing the house apart and i keep thinking we will not have any house left if we continue. I thought we would be able to get away with one 30yard construction dumpster and we are on #3 and i am worried it's still not going to be enough. we are over budget $875 on the First Item. The cost of Demo is going to be about $2500 that includes the removal of two large dead trees next to the house that was around $1000 The rest is labor, i have contributed quite a bit to this part of the project.

The plan

The original house is about 15oo sq feet and the new plan is to add about 300feet with a master suite where a current covered porch sits . We are also adding about 300 feet to the front of the house and extending a living room to make it about 2x its current size. Don't be confused- the lay outs are turned on the plan. The front of the house is to the left of first scan directly below the post. The orig layout is the bottom scan and the front of the house sits on the bottom of the the plan. we are completely opening up the kitchen to both living areas and adding a laundry. we have raised the ceilings in the whole house. some of ceilings in the house were barely 7.5 feet. we were able to raise the ceilings in the living areas quite a bit- it wont even look like the same house. This is a complete Gut. You name it, we are replacing it. we have a budget of $85k. That includes new appliances, which were able to get at atleast half price because a local appliance store was going out of business -$2500 total.
